2014-11-04 4 views
0

Я работаю над веб-приложением на основе службы Spring REST (пользовательский интерфейс основан на HTML5, backbone.js). Фактическое требование: загруженный документ (может быть любой документ, такой как excel, word, ppt, pdf и т. Д.) Требует опции предварительного просмотра, с помощью которой пользователь может просматривать документ в браузере (у пользователя может быть установлен офис или нет).Преобразование docx/ODT в изображение с использованием Java

Моей идеей является преобразование документов в изображения и их отображение пользователю. При поиске я нашел несколько способов конвертировать PDF в изображение, но не много ODT для изображения (Примечание: я ищу открытый исходный код). JODConverter, docx4j можно использовать для преобразования документов в pdf. Затем я могу конвертировать эти PDF-файлы в изображения. Но это правильный путь. Есть ли другой эффективный способ добиться того же. Пожалуйста, предложите и назовите меня в правильном направлении.

Заранее спасибо. Gopi

ответ

1

Да, вы не будете лучше, чем .docx, до .pdf. Вам действительно нужен стабильный рабочий процесс, и это так же хорошо, как вы найдете для этой цели, если только вы не работаете на сервере Microsoft, и у вас есть доступ к официальным материалам Microsoft Office.

Для превью, docx4j или аналогичные будут делать все отлично. Не все прекрасно конвертируется, но для предварительного просмотра должно быть хорошо.

+0

спасибо большое. Будет следовать одному и тому же методу. – user2928305

Смежные вопросы